Robotic telestenting performance in transcontinental and regional pre‐clinical models

Abstract: Objectives This study was conducted to evaluate the association of geographic distance with robotic telestenting performance by comparing performance measures in transcontinental and regional pre‐clinical models of telestenting. Background Robotic telestenting, in which percutaneous coronary intervention (PCI) is performed on a remotely located patient, might improve PCI access, but has not been attempted over vast distances likely required to reach many underserved regions. “…The use of endovascular simulators for device and workflow evaluation purposes have been described before with the CorPath robotic system. Madder et al 9,10 tested the feasibility of tele-PCI in a simulator model, and showed successful balloon/stent delivery and deployment to preselected coronary arteries, but no previous studies evaluated the performance of robotic tele-PVI. SFA interventional case simulations were selected for this study.…”

“…The ability to perform efficient and safe procedures over the internet depends on the lag time, which is unfelt for latencies less than 250 ms. The measured latency in the human study was 53 ms 80 . Recently, 5G wireless networks have been opening a whole range of possibilities for remote procedures.…”
